The Detroit Tigers secured a 3-0 victory over the Cleveland Guardians on August 13, 2026, making it the first K-less shutout in MLB in 12 years. Detroit's pitching, led by Keider Montero, Tyler Holton, and Kenley Jansen, did not register a strikeout but limited Cleveland to four hits. The Tigers took the lead in the third inning with a run from Javier Báez and increased their advantage with a home run from Eduardo Valencia in the sixth. The Guardians are on a downward trend, losing nine of their last 12 games, now sitting four games back in the AL Central.
